Description of cargofretebrasil.com.br
cargofretebrasil.com.br appears to present itself as a Brazilian freight and logistics marketplace under the brand name "Fluxo Frete." Based on the homepage text in Portuguese, the site is intended to connect cargo shippers with drivers or transport providers, allowing users to publish loads, find freight opportunities, and manage deliveries through a digital platform.
The branding and messaging suggest a transportation-technology or logistics service focused on the Brazilian market. The page includes account actions such as login and registration, along with claims about published freight listings, active drivers, and completed deliveries. No clear operator identity is visible in the provided screenshot, so the exact company behind the site cannot be confirmed from the available scan data alone.
Safety Assessment for cargofretebrasil.com.br
This domain shows mixed signals at the time of the scan. One out of 91 security engines flagged it for phishing, while the remaining engines did not report a detection. A separate malware scan marked the main page as potentially suspicious, but it did not identify a specific malware family or show broader malicious activity across the site. External links and referenced domains reviewed in that scan were not flagged.
At the same time, several stronger reputation checks were clean: major threat-database and blacklist checks did not report the domain, and the domain's IP address was not listed on the checked mail-reputation blocklists. The visible homepage also resembles a functioning logistics platform rather than a parked or obviously broken site. However, the domain is only 3 days old and has no established traffic ranking, which increases uncertainty because newly registered domains can carry higher risk until they build a longer track record.
Taken together, the single-engine phishing flag and the very recent registration date are cautionary factors, while the broader blacklist results are cleaner and the additional suspicious finding appears low-confidence. Based on these findings, this website may pose potential risks, and users should exercise caution at the time of this scan.
Technical Description
The site uses a valid Let's Encrypt SSL certificate that was active at the time of the scan, which indicates that traffic can be encrypted in transit. The domain resolves to an IP address hosted through NIC.BR infrastructure in São Paulo, Brazil. The web server software and supported TLS protocol details were not identified in the provided data.
DNSSEC status is unknown, and the domain uses a.auto.dns.br and b.auto.dns.br nameservers. From a technical risk perspective, the main concerns are not certificate-related but rather the domain's extremely recent registration, the lack of registrar transparency in the provided record, and the limited operating history available for reputation assessment.
